OfferPriceRS - LongSell

  • <Document>

  • <Success>

  • <ShoppingResponseID>

  • <PricedOffer>

  • <DataLists>

  • <Metadata>

User Guidance

Input Parameters

Type

Mandatory/ Optional

Request Object

OfferPriceRS

M

<OfferPriceRS>

XML Example for the following elements

<OfferPriceRS Version="17.2" xmlns="http://www.iata.org/IATA/EDIST">

Elements

Details

Mandatory/ Optional

Version (Attribute)

Specify NDC schema message version. Always pass 17.2
Note: This is a mandatory attribute in NDC schema. The service will not validate what is being passed in this attribute

M

Document

Elements

Details

Mandatory/ Optional

<Document>

NDC Message Document information

M

Document name will be always "NDC

o

It will be NDC version

o

Success

Elements

Details

Mandatory/Optional

The presence of the empty Success element explicitly indicates that the message succeeded

M

ShoppingResponseID

Elements

Details

Mandatory/Optional

Unique shopping session response ID.

Ā 

PricedOffer

Elements

Details

Mandatory/Optional

This returns total fare, fare per passenger type and tax details along with fare rules for the requested itinerary

M

A unique offer ID

M

V1

M

This is the time by which offer will remain in the system to be used by subsequent APIs calling ā€˜Order by referenceā€™ method.

Example: 2018-08-07T07:47:14.643Z

Ā 

O

This should be repeated for each passenger

M

Unique ID

Example : V1_OFFERITEM.1560995778608

M

Ā 

M

This returns the total price of the offer for all the passenger requested per passenger type

M

Ā 

M

Total Amount

M

Currency code. Example: TRY

M

Ā 

M

Ā 

M

Amount

M

Currency. Example: TRY

M

Ā 

M

Total tax amount

M

Currency. Example: TRY

M

Gives tax breakdown

Ā 

Tax amount

M

Country code. Example: TR

M

Tax code

M

Base amount

M

Currency. Example TRY

M

Discount if applicable

Ā 

Discount amount

Ā 

Currency. Example TRY

Ā 

Surcharges

M

Ā 

M

Total surcharge amount

M

Currency. Example TRY

M

Breakdown of surcharges

M

Surcharge amount

M

Currency. Example: TRY

M

Example: FUEL

M

Description of surcharge

Ā 

This returns the service this Offer Item is entitled to.

M

A unique id eg V1_SRVC.1560995778611

M

This returns the passenger reference for all the passengers for who the service is applicable.

Each reference is delimited by a space.

Example: V1_PAX.1 V1_PAX.2

Each passenger reference should be detailed in Passenger List under Data Lists

M

This return the all the flight references which are part of this service.

Each reference is delimited by a space.

Example: V1_SEG.1560995803085 V1_SEG.1560995803086

Each Flight reference should be detailed in Flight List under Data Lists

Ā 

M

This returns Fare Rules and price detail applicable to flights & passenger type respectively applicable to this Offer Item

O

Price returned per passenger type with total price, fare & tax along with the breakdown

M

The total amount per passenger type

O

Total amount (Base fare + Tax) per passenger type for the itinerary

M

Currency code

O

Base fare per passenger type for the itinerary

M

Currency code

O

Surcharge

M

Ā 

Ā 

Total surcharge

M

Currency code

O

This returns taxes per passenger type for the itinerary

O

Total tax

O

Currency code

O

Repeat Fare Component per Origin & Destination

O

This returns Fare Rules for the flights

O

This returns reference to all the segments applicable

O

<DataList>

Passenger details

M

Flight details

M

Service details

M

Seat details

M

<Metadata>

Includes FareDetailAugPoint, ItineraryAmountDetailAugPoint, FareComponentAugPoint

M

Includes TravellerAugPoint

M

Other metadatas to be included

M

Includes TaxDetailAugPoint

M